当前位置:首页 > 编程技术 > 正文

如何打开5222端口

如何打开5222端口

打开5222端口通常是为了允许某些网络服务(如某些即时通讯软件的服务器)在你的计算机上运行。以下是在Windows和Linux系统上打开5222端口的步骤: Windo...

打开5222端口通常是为了允许某些网络服务(如某些即时通讯软件的服务器)在你的计算机上运行。以下是在Windows和Linux系统上打开5222端口的步骤:

Windows系统

1. 打开控制面板:点击“开始”按钮,然后选择“控制面板”。

2. 打开“Windows Defender 防火墙”:在控制面板中找到并点击“系统和安全”,然后点击“Windows Defender 防火墙”。

3. 允许应用或功能通过Windows Defender 防火墙:在左侧菜单中选择“允许应用或功能通过Windows Defender 防火墙”。

4. 更改设置:在右侧点击“更改设置”。

5. 允许另一个应用:点击“允许另一个应用”或“更改设置”。

6. 选择程序:浏览并选择你想要允许的软件,然后点击“添加”。

7. 选择5222端口:在“程序和服务”列表中找到并选择你的软件,然后勾选“TCP”和“UDP”下的5222端口。

8. 确定:点击“确定”保存更改。

Linux系统

1. 打开终端:在Linux系统中,打开终端。

2. 检查防火墙状态:大多数Linux系统使用iptables或firewalld作为防火墙。你可以使用以下命令检查防火墙状态:

`iptables -L`(对于iptables)

`firewall-cmd --list-all`(对于firewalld)

3. 允许5222端口:

使用iptables:

```bash

sudo iptables -A INPUT -p tcp --dport 5222 -j ACCEPT

sudo iptables -A INPUT -p udp --dport 5222 -j ACCEPT

```

使用firewalld:

```bash

sudo firewall-cmd --permanent --add-port=5222/tcp

sudo firewall-cmd --permanent --add-port=5222/udp

```

4. 重启防火墙:

使用iptables:

```bash

sudo service iptables restart

```

使用firewalld:

```bash

sudo firewall-cmd --reload

```

完成以上步骤后,5222端口应该已经打开,允许相关的网络服务在你的计算机上运行。如果你在尝试连接时仍然遇到问题,请确保没有其他防火墙或安全软件阻止了该端口。

最新文章